Easy hiking trails in Tenerife traverse a diverse volcanic landscape, ranging from lush laurel forests in the north to arid, lunar-like terrains in Teide National Park. The island's varied topography includes coastal paths, deep gorges, and gentle hills, offering a wide array of environments for outdoor exploration. These routes provide accessible options for different fitness levels, focusing on shorter distances and minimal elevation gain.

Tenerife offers a wide selection of easy hiking trails. There are over 1,400 easy routes recorded on komoot, providing numerous options for gentle exploration across the island's diverse landscapes.
Easy hikes in Tenerife showcase a remarkable variety of landscapes. You can explore lush laurel forests, unique volcanic badlands, and trails with views of Mount Teide. The island's volcanic origin means you'll encounter everything from ancient woodlands to lunar-like terrains, even on less strenuous paths.
Yes, many easy trails in Tenerife are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the Malpais de Guimar - circular from El Puertito de Guimar offers an easy loop through a unique volcanic landscape, and the Trail PNT 13: Sámara loop provides a circular route with stunning views of Mount Teide.
Tenerife has many family-friendly easy hikes. Trails like The Forest of Enigmas Trail are ideal, offering shaded paths through ancient laurel forests that are engaging for all ages. These routes typically have minimal elevation gain and shorter distances, making them suitable for families.
On easy hikes, you can discover a range of natural features. The Forest of Enigmas Trail leads through ancient laurel forests in Anaga Rural Park. In the south, you might encounter unique rock formations resembling a lunar surface. You can also find highlights like Charcas de Erjos, a lake, or various coastal viewpoints.
Tenerife is a fantastic year-round destination for hiking due to its mild climate. While enjoyable conditions can be found throughout the year, the months of October and May are particularly popular for hiking, offering pleasant temperatures and generally stable weather.
Easy hikes in Tenerife are generally shorter and less strenuous. For instance, The Forest of Enigmas Trail is about 3.2 miles (5.1 km) and takes around 1 hour 30 minutes. The Trail PNT 13: Sámara loop, at 3.1 miles (4.9 km), typically takes about 1 hour 36 minutes.
Yes, many easy hiking trails in Tenerife have parking available at or near their trailheads. Renting a car is often recommended for accessing various hiking regions across the island, and you'll typically find designated parking areas, especially for popular routes.
Absolutely. Several easy trails provide spectacular views of Mount Teide, Spain's highest peak. The Trail PNT 13: Sámara loop is a prime example, leading through volcanic terrain with panoramic vistas of the volcano.

Yes, Tenerife is home to ancient laurel forests, particularly in Anaga Rural Park. The Forest of Enigmas Trail is an excellent easy option that takes you directly through these unique, relic forests, offering a shaded and tranquil experience.
Tenerife offers stunning coastal trails that are suitable for easy walks. While specific routes vary, you can find paths that provide breathtaking views of the sea and cliffs, such as sections of the Rambla de Castro, which offers gentle strolls along the La Orotava Valley shoreline.
Definitely. Tenerife's volcanic origin means many easy hikes traverse unique volcanic terrains. The Malpais de Guimar - circular from El Puertito de Guimar is an easy path that explores a distinctive volcanic badlands landscape near the coast, while trails in Teide National Park offer views of craters and lava flows.
